Instacart to pay $60 million in refunds after feds allege it deceived customers – CBS News
Instacart has agreed to refund $60 million to customers to settle allegations that the grocery shopping service engaged in deceptive marketing and billing practices, the Federal Trade Commission said Thursday. The agency alleged in a lawsuit that Instacart charged hidden fees and refused to issue refunds, raising the cost of groceries for consumers and harming shoppers. …
